What's Happening?
MiniMax has introduced Music 3.0, an advanced AI model designed to generate complete songs from creative concepts and optional lyrics. The model focuses on capturing the creator's expressive intent, sustaining it across a full song, and rendering instruments
and vocals with high fidelity. Music 3.0 features a redesigned generation pipeline, including a Hybrid-LM for modeling long-range structure and acoustic detail, and a multi-layer residual vector quantization system for improved sound quality. These innovations aim to deliver more accurate interpretations of creative intent, varied arrangements, and natural sound, making professional music creation more accessible.
